Pre-Sales Engineer
AscomJob Description
About the Role
Do you enjoy visiting customer sites, demonstrating cutting‑edge healthcare technology, and working in an environment where no two days are the same? If you’re passionate about technology and enjoy working closely with customers and sales teams, this could be the role for you. As a Pre‑Sales Engineer at Ascom, you’ll play a key role at the front end of our business, demonstrating our solutions and helping healthcare providers deliver expert care to their communities.
What You'll Be Doing
In this varied and hands‑on role, you’ll be responsible for:
- Preparing technical and engineering inputs to develop sales tools that support our sales teams and resellers in learning and presenting Ascom’s solution portfolio.
- Delivering engaging web‑based demonstrations and technical seminars to customers and reseller partners.
- Collaborating with sales, marketing, and product teams by providing technical input into marketing activities, market planning, and product and service development.

About You
To succeed in this role, you’ll bring:
- A tertiary qualification in Information Technology or a related discipline.
- Experience working with IT, telecommunications, or wireless technologies (such as DECT or 802.11).
- Strong communication skills and confidence presenting technical solutions to diverse audiences.
- Familiarity with Ascom’s solutions is highly regarded, but not essential.
